摘要
This contribution summarizes results of several numerical methods developed at our department. Presented methods are based on central TVD schemes, upwind TVD schemes with or without Riemann solver, ENO schemes and Lax-Wendroff type schemes. The results of 2D methods, computed on either structured quadrilateral grids or unstructured grids composed of triangles and quadrilaterals, are compared on 2D axial and radial turbine cascade and 2D axial compressor cascade. A comparison of results, obtained on structured hexahedral grids, is shown for 3D axial turbine cascade of Skoda Pilsen enterprise.
